Chip-scale integrated tuning of slow-light in all-optical multi-EIT analogue in photonic crystal cavities

We present the integrated chip-scale tuning of multiple photonic crystal cavities. The optimized implementation allows for large tuning (20K/mW), with deterministic resonance control towards all-optical analogue to electromagnetically-induced-transparency on-chip.
